Disneysea was our stop for the 3rd day in Tokyo. I was bouncing around in excitement at the prospect of taking scary thrilling rides and being immersed in the Disney fun. Sister was much calmer though, since she has already visited 2 Disneylands and was probably just entertaining my want of a Disneyland/sea.

Our train rides took 2 hours - from Fuda station to Tokyo station, then to Maihama via the Keiyo line. -_-”

After a rushrushrush for the ‘20 000 Leagues Under the Sea’ ride, we joined the rest of the Disneyworld by the harbour to watch BraviSEAmo!, a dramatic tale of a graceful ’spirit of water’ and a powerful ’spirit of fire’ which used music, fountains and fiery effects.
